I think itā€™s similar to Signal to use in someways, except for the ID, which is a long string of text, similar to the following:

05b17ca9535cf51ef290424f61f2342e38751ade509e27e64998afa92147fb5f5a

Instead of a mobile phone number like Signal. It does have a QR code feature you can use to add people as well.

They do have a linux client though (AppImage format) which seems to work OK. They are based in Australia and are well aware of, and following closely, our latest encryption laws which Governments would currently be hard-pressed to get much out of Session.

I mentioned it here somewhere and I use it on an Android phone installed from F-Droid, that is actually cool unlike Signal. It works basically like Signal, is based on it and uses the same encryption protocol but it is really slow and has less features and obviously no one else is using it.
It not only is private and secure, it also is anonymous because you do not need a phone number.
